Output ed9a39e96248915519dfc6f23373f786ba55b19a7d3b7129a84d83cc222942fc:7

value
3661847231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ff49ff0f64f3e7bf8b05d55f13a915bcdd51a4 OP_EQUAL
address
MKfEYn7AjUoe6ogx6w3NEJjQXEGFMjA8Yh
transaction
ed9a39e96248915519dfc6f23373f786ba55b19a7d3b7129a84d83cc222942fc
spent
true